What to Consider When Choosing a Robot Vacuum:

Choosing the best robot vacuum includes more than simply picking the flashiest design. Thoroughly think about the following aspects to ensure you pick a gadget that really satisfies your needs and provides value:
Budget: Robot vacuums range in rate from under ₤ 200 to over ₤ 1000. Identify your spending plan upfront to limit your alternatives. Keep in mind that greater cost points often correlate with advanced functions like smarter navigation, more powerful suction, and self-emptying capabilities.Floor Types: Consider the dominant floor types in your home. Residences with mainly tough floors might gain from models with mopping functions, while homes with thick carpets require strong suction power and brush roll designs engineered for carpet cleaning. Some models are versatile and carry out well on both hard floorings and carpets.Pet Ownership: Pet hair is a common cleaning difficulty. If you have pets, try to find robot vacuums particularly designed to take on pet hair. These typically include tangle-free brush rolls, robust suction, and effective filtration systems to capture irritants.Home Size and Layout: Larger homes or those with multiple levels might demand robot vacuums with longer battery life and smart mapping features to ensure complete cleaning protection. Houses with intricate layouts and various barriers will benefit from sophisticated navigation systems.Smart Features and Connectivity: Do you desire app control, scheduling, virtual walls, or voice assistant integration? Smart includes enhance convenience and customisation but frequently come at a higher cost.Navigation and Mapping:Random Bounce: Basic designs frequently utilize random bounce navigation, which is less effective however can still clean up successfully in smaller spaces.Systematic Navigation (LiDAR or Camera-based): More advanced models utilize LiDAR (Light Detection and Ranging) or camera-based systems to map your home and browse methodically. This leads to more efficient cleaning, room-by-room cleaning, and the capability to set virtual boundaries.Suction Power: Measured in Pascals (Pa), suction power figures out how effectively a robot vacuum selects up dirt and debris. Greater suction is normally better, particularly for carpets and pet hair.Battery Life and Charging: Battery life determines how long the robot vacuum can work on a single charge. Think about the size of your home and pick a model with sufficient battery life to clean it efficiently. Automatic recharging is a standard function, where the robot go back to its dock when the battery is low.Self-Emptying Feature: Some premium models feature self-emptying bases. These bases instantly suck the dust and debris from the robot's dustbin into a larger, disposable bag, significantly minimizing the frequency of manual dustbin clearing and boosting benefit.Sound Level: Robot vacuums differ in sound output. If sound level of sensitivity is a concern, try to find designs advertised as quiet operating.

Tips for Getting one of the most Out of Your Robot Vacuum:

To ensure your robot vacuum operates successfully and effectively for several years to come, think about these handy ideas:
Prepare Your Home: Before running your robot vacuum, declutter your floorings by removing loose cable televisions, small toys, and other challenges that could impede its navigation or get tangled in the brushes.Regular Maintenance: Empty the dustbin regularly (or less frequently with self-emptying models), tidy the brushes and filters as advised by the manufacturer, and look for any obstructions or wear and tear.Set Up Cleaning Sessions: Utilize the scheduling feature to set your robot vacuum to clean automatically at practical times, such as when you are at work or asleep.Use Virtual Boundaries: If your robot vacuum has virtual wall or zoned cleaning features, utilize them to prevent the robot from going into particular areas or to target cleaning to specific rooms.Monitor Performance: Occasionally observe your robot vacuum in action to ensure it is cleaning effectively and navigating properly. Attend to any concerns promptly.Keep Software Updated: If your robot vacuum has app connectivity, guarantee you keep the firmware and app upgraded to gain from the current features and performance improvements.
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s):
Q: Are robot vacuums worth the investment?A: For busy people and those looking for to reduce their cleaning workload, robot vacuums can be a worthwhile financial investment. They automate a tiresome chore and can maintain a regularly cleaner home.Q: Can robot vacuums change traditional vacuums totally?A: Robot vacuums are excellent for regular maintenance cleaning but might not entirely replace conventional vacuums for deep cleaning tasks, corner cleaning, or cleaning upholstery and stairs. Many users discover they supplement their robot vacuum with a conventional vacuum for more intensive cleaning.Q: How often should I run my robot vacuum?A: Daily cleaning is perfect for keeping a regularly tidy home, especially in households with family pets or children. Nevertheless, you can adjust the frequency based upon your requirements and household traffic.Q: Do robot vacuums work on carpets and carpets?A: Yes, numerous robot vacuums are designed to work on both tough floorings and carpets. Try to find models with strong suction and brush rolls created for carpet cleaning efficiency.Q: How long do robot vacuums typically last?A: With correct upkeep, a great quality robot vacuum can last for several years, typically 3-5 years or longer depending on usage and brand.Q: Are robot vacuums noisy?A: Robot vacuums usually produce less sound than conventional vacuums, however sound levels differ in between designs. Some designs are specifically developed for quieter operation.Q: What is the distinction between LiDAR and camera-based navigation?A: LiDAR (Light Detection and Ranging) uses lasers to produce a detailed map of your home, using accurate navigation and efficient cleaning paths. Camera-based systems use visual info to navigate. LiDAR is normally considered more accurate and reliable in low-light conditions.
